Class A TOD Residential Community Breaks Ground Within Crestview Neighborhood On North Lamar Boulevard


AUSTIN, TX –
High Street Residential and Principal Real Estate Investors have broken ground on Crestview Commons, a Class A 4-story residential project comprised of 353 units, including 1, 2, and 3 bedrooms. The project sits adjacent to the Crestview MetroRail station at North Lamar Street and Sugaree Avenue. Pre-leasing will commence in January 2018.

The Crestview Commons apartments will range from 642-to-1,405 square feet. Indoor residential amenities include a conference room, resident lounge, entertaining kitchen, a top-floor indoor and outdoor clubroom with views of downtown, Wi-Fi throughout the common areas and a well-equipped fitness center. Outdoor amenities will offer three courtyards: one providing an active fresh air appeal for residents to exercise and do yoga with the fitness center doors opening up to the area, a relaxation courtyard, and a pool courtyard with a resort style pool and pool area including sunbathing shelves, water features, fire pits and grills. Lastly, for the dog lover’s there will be direct access to a 7,000-square-foot partially shaded dog park. The project will have sustainable building features and will be seeking LEED® certification.
 
Crestview Commons is well-positioned for easy access to the greater Austin area. The site has quick and convenient access to downtown on N. Lamar Blvd., US-183, Interstate 35, US-290 and MoPac. 
 
The project architect is JHP Architecture. Andres Construction will serve as general contractor. 
 
Construction financing is being provided by Comerica Bank and Southside Bank.

Trammell Crow Company

Trammell Crow Company (TCC) is a global commercial real estate developer and wholly-owned subsidiary of CBRE Group, Inc. (NYSE:CBRE), a Fortune 500 and S&P 500 company headquartered in Dallas. Founded in 1948, TCC has developed or acquired nearly 2,900 buildings valued at $75 billion and over 655 million square feet. As of September 30, 2024, TCC had $19 billion of projects in process and $13.4 billion in its pipeline. With 575 employees throughout the United States and Europe in 26 offices, the company serves users of and investors in office, industrial/logistics, healthcare, life science, data center and mixed-use projects, as well as multi-family residential through its operating subsidiary High Street Residential.
